Comprehending Site Addresses

A site address, or URL, is a string of characters that defines the place of a resource on the web. URLs normally consist of numerous components:

  1. Protocol: The method utilized to access the resource, such as HTTP (Hypertext Transfer Protocol) or HTTPS (HTTP Secure).
  2. Subdomain: A segment of the domain name, such as "www" in "www.example.com".
  3. Domain Name: The primary part of the URL, such as "example.com".
  4. Path: The specific place of the resource on the server, such as "/ blog/post".

Tools for Efficient URL Gathering

To make the procedure of gathering site addresses more effective, a number of tools and software application can be made use of:

  1. Web Crawlers:

    • Scrapy: An open-source Python structure for web scraping.
    • Apify: A cloud-based platform for building and running web scrapers.
    • Octoparse: An user-friendly tool for web data extraction.
  2. Link Harvesters:

    • Xenu's Link Sleuth: A totally free tool that inspects sites for broken links and collects URL information.
    • Link Grabber: 주고모음 A web browser extension that extracts all links from a website.
  3. Internet browser Extensions:

    • OneTab: Converts numerous open tabs into a single list of URLs.
    • LinkClump: Allows users to choose and open several links with a single click.
    • Pocket: Saves websites for later reading and supplies a list of conserved URLs.
  4. Search Engine Tools:

    • Google Search Console: Provides insights into a site's efficiency and assists in determining URLs.
    • Bing Webmaster Tools: Offers similar functionalities to Google Search Console.

Frequently Asked Questions on Gathering Site Addresses

Q1: What is the difference between a web crawler and a link harvester?

Q2: How can I inspect if a URL is broken?

  • A2: You can utilize tools like Xenu's Link Sleuth or the Broken Link Checker internet browser extension to test and determine broken links.

Q3: Are there any legal problems with web scraping?

  • A3: Yes, web scraping can raise legal issues, particularly if it breaks the regards to service of a site or infringes on data privacy laws. Constantly guarantee you have the right to scrape information from a site.

Q4: Can I utilize search engines to gather URLs?

  • A4: Yes, search engines like Google and Bing offer sophisticated search operators that can assist in finding particular URLs. For instance, using "site: example.com" will note all pages on the "example.com" domain.

Q5: What are some common uses of collected site addresses?

  • A5: Gathered site addresses can be utilized for material curation, SEO analysis, academic research study, and producing comprehensive directory sites or databases of online resources.
